Neville's Island is a comedy by Tim Firth (1964-) [1].

The original text

A play about four British businessmen on a team-building weekend November on a small island in Derwentwater. The men differ greatly in character, none really fit for a crisis in the outdoors.

The play was first shown at the Stephen Joseph Theatre in the Round at Westwood, England in June 1992.


Translations and adaptations

A television film version was screened on 4 June 1998 on ITV, directed by Terry Johnson,

Performance history in South Africa

1995: Performed by PACT Drama at the Alexander Theatre, Johannesburg, directed by Alan Swerdlow with a cast that included James Borthwick.
